Mastering the Terrain: Unrivaled Off-Road Prowess and Engineering
While the HEMI provides the brawn, it’s the meticulously engineered drivetrain and chassis that truly unlock the Moab 392’s legendary off-road capability. This isn’t just an engine shoehorned into a Wrangler; it’s a comprehensively upgraded machine designed to conquer. At the forefront of its trail-dominating arsenal are the 17-inch beadlock wheels, expertly wrapped in formidable 35-inch all-terrain tires. For the uninitiated, beadlock wheels are not just for show; they are a critical component for serious off-roading. They mechanically secure the tire bead to the wheel, allowing drivers to significantly air down their tires for maximum traction on challenging surfaces like sand or rocks, without the risk of the tire detaching from the rim. This kind of off-road tire technology is invaluable, providing an enormous competitive advantage when the going gets tough.
Complementing this robust wheel and tire package is the 2.72:1 Selec-Trac full-time transfer case. Having spent countless hours dissecting the nuances of various 4×4 systems, I can confidently say that Selec-Trac offers an exceptional balance of versatility and robustness. Unlike part-time systems, Selec-Trac allows for all-wheel drive on pavement, making it a safer and more stable daily driver in varying weather conditions, yet it retains serious low-range gearing for tackling extreme obstacles. This advanced traction system intelligently distributes torque, ensuring optimal grip across diverse terrains, from slippery mud to loose gravel. When combined with heavy-duty axles and a factory-tuned suspension lift to accommodate those 35-inch tires, the Moab 392 boasts impressive ground clearance and best-in-class approach and departure angles, crucial for navigating treacherous trails without damage.

Strategic Enhancements and Unlocking Customization Potential
Beyond the core features, Jeep has equipped the Moab 392 with a suite of strategic enhancements and optional equipment that further amplify its appeal and utility. The body-color hardtop, for instance, offers a cohesive, premium aesthetic that distinguishes it from more utilitarian Wranglers, while still providing the renowned security and insulation of a hardtop. It’s a blend of style and substance that resonates with buyers who appreciate both form and function.
For those who demand the absolute maximum in capability, the optional 8,000-pound Warn winch is a game-changer. As an experienced off-roader, I can attest to the invaluable nature of a robust recovery system. Having a factory-integrated Warn winch not only ensures proper installation and warranty coverage but also provides immediate peace of mind, knowing you have the means to extract yourself (or others) from tricky situations. This critical piece of vehicle customization options demonstrates Jeep’s commitment to equipping enthusiasts for serious challenges.
Another highly coveted option is the Sky One-Touch Powertop. This innovative feature transforms the open-air experience of a Wrangler from a manual, multi-step process into a simple press of a button. In mere seconds, the soft top retracts, offering an exhilarating connection to the elements – perfect for enjoying a starry night sky or soaking in the sun on a scenic drive. This blend of convenience and classic Wrangler freedom truly enhances the ownership experience, appealing to those who love the convertible aspect but appreciate modern ease of use. “Twelve 4 Twelve”: A Legacy Unveiled, A Market Transformed
The 2026 Jeep Wrangler Moab 392 is more than a vehicle; it’s a monumental first step in Jeep’s “Twelve 4 Twelve” initiative, celebrating its 85th anniversary in 2026. This ambitious strategy of releasing a new limited-edition Wrangler every month for a year is a masterclass in brand engagement and a potent move in the 2025 automotive market. Each successive model will delve into a different facet of Jeep’s rich heritage and vibrant fan community, building anticipation with every monthly “symbolic airdrop,” a nod to the brand’s wartime roots via the “Operation Airdrop” social media campaign. This strategic rollout positions each limited run vehicle not just as a new product, but as a collectible piece of automotive history.
For enthusiasts and collectors, this series represents a unique opportunity to own a piece of Jeep’s evolving legacy. These aren’t just Wranglers with a few badges; each is configured with specific themes and features, ensuring their distinctiveness and bolstering their status as automotive heritage models. The Moab 392, specifically, pays tribute to the 60th anniversary of the iconic Easter Jeep Safari in Moab, Utah – a place synonymous with the brand’s extreme off-road testing and culture.
